On a humid March night in 1957, Kwame Nkrumah made history.

While thousands of people cheered, including dignitaries from round the world, he announced his country's independence.

After many years of British rule, Ghana, formerly the Gold Coast, became the first sub-Saharan African nation to break free from colonial rule.

Kwame Nkrumah's Midnight Speech for Independence shares the story of Nkrumah's historic declaration of Ghana's independence and the years of struggle that led to that celebrated event.
